Job Description:

We are seeking a Junior Software Developer to join our Submarine Combat System Development Team. In this role, you will be developing critical tactical software for the U.S. Navy submarine fleet, playing a key part in supporting mission-critical projects and ensuring seamless integration and functionality both in laboratory environments and onboard submarines.

The ideal candidate will bring expertise in software development, including client-server applications in a Linux environment, and proficiency with programming languages such as C/C++, QT, or Java. Strong written and verbal communication skills are essential. Experience with the BYG-1 Combat Control System is a plus. If you enjoy solving complex challenges and working with cutting-edge technology, this could be the perfect opportunity for you!

This is a full-time position based either in Manassas, Virginia or Middletown Rhode Island. U.S. citizenship is required along with an active a DOD Secret Clearance. The annual base salary is $75,000 - $120,000, with final compensation based on experience and skills. Candidates will be paid within this range based on their work experience and skills.

In addition to a competitive base salary, this position is eligible for a sign-on bonus and a comprehensive benefits package, including healthcare benefits (medical, dental, and vision), Flexible Spending Accounts, Life Insurance, a 401(k) plan with matching company contributions, paid time off and holidays, and tuition and training reimbursement.
